Technical Specifications
Type: 2-component addition curing silicone
Low Temperature Resistance: Long-term use temperature -100℃ to 200℃, no brittle fracture at -100℃ (ASTM D746), cold resistance grade ≥Class 5, low-temperature stability ≥95%, no performance degradation in cryogenic environments
Foaming Feature: Fine uniform closed-cell pores (20-40μm), low-temperature resistant structure, dense pore distribution, uniform cold resistance, no structural damage, structural integrity in ultra-low temperature environments
Mixing Ratio: 1:1 (Part A:Part B, by weight)
Cure Method: Room-temperature or heated (80℃, 1h) vulcanization
Certifications: SGS eco-toxicity, RoHS, SGS low temperature resistance test certification
Key Traits: Ultra-low temperature resistant (-100℃ long-term use), cold-resistant, no brittle fracture
Packaging: Part A (20/25/200KG/barrel), Part B (20/25/200KG/barrel)

How to Use
1. Take Part A and Part B according to 1:1 weight ratio, stir separately to eliminate sediment, ensure no impurities (avoid affecting low temperature resistance).
2. Mix and stir thoroughly for 3 minutes until homogeneous, vacuum degas to remove air bubbles (ensure uniform low temperature resistance and closed-cell structure, no structural damage).
3. Pour the mixture into low-temperature resistant component mold (paired with industrial mold silicone rubber), foam and cure at room temperature or by heating (heating helps enhance low-temperature stability).
4. After full curing, test low temperature resistance (no brittle fracture at -100℃) to confirm qualification, then use in ultra-low temperature and cryogenic scenarios.
